The Role


Wood currently has an opportunity for a Contracts Administrator - Project Controls (CA-PC) to join the Mining & Minerals business. Functionally reporting to the Manager, Supply Chain and the site Construction Manager, this role combines contract administration and project controls responsibilities to support successful delivery of the Denison Wheeler River Project. The position is responsible for post-award contract administration, change management, cost control, schedule impact assessment and progress monitoring.


The CA-PC is part of the project team specializing in the management of large construction and service contracts. The role ensures contractual compliance while providing robust project controls oversight for changes, forecasting, reporting, cost tracking, and schedule assessment throughout the project lifecycle.

Responsibilities

Typical responsibilities:


  • Manage, coordinate and administer contracts to ensure cost and schedule compliance.

  • Manage the contract change order process for in-scope and out-of-scope work.

  • Develop and maintain construction progress activities utilizing project management systems.

  • Assist with monthly project reports for construction progress, contract status, cost, and schedule performance.

  • Monitor contract performance, identify risks, and support mitigation strategies.

  • Coordinate contract closeout activities and project handover requirements.

  • Maintain project controls data including change logs, commitments, forecasts, and progress tracking.

  • Support cost control earned progress measurement, forecasting, and management reporting.

  • Review contractor submissions for completeness, accuracy, and contractual compliance. 

  • Lead the administration of Contract Change Orders (CCOs), ensuring scope, cost, schedule impacts, risks, and assumptions are clearly defined and documented.

  • Review and validate contractor change submissions for accuracy, completeness, contractual compliance, and pricing integrity.

  • Maintain change logs, contract value reporting, forecasts, and Delegation of Authority (DoA) compliance tracking.

  • Evaluate schedule impacts, critical path implications, and mitigation opportunities associated with contract changes.

  • Coordinate with engineering, construction, project controls, and supply chain stakeholders to support scope, cost, and schedule evaluations.

  • Identify, communicate, and manage commercial risks, assumptions, information gaps, and potential cost and schedule exposures.

  • Prepare commercial evaluations and recommendations to support approvals.

  • Maintain project controls records, including commitments, forecasts, trends, progress measurement, and change management data.

  • Monitor contractor performance and contract compliance, recommending actions to mitigate commercial, financial, and schedule risks.

  • Support commercial strategy development, contract negotiations, claims management, and dispute resolution activities.

  • Ensure contracts and change management activities comply with project governance, approval requirements, and corporate procedures.

  • Prepare commercial and project controls reporting for project leadership and senior management.

  • Drive contractor accountability through performance monitoring, progress reviews, and issue resolution.

Expected:


  • 8-15 years of contract administration experience within EPC/EPCM projects, preferably heavy industrial construction environments.

  • Experience with project controls, cost control, change management, forecasting, and schedule analysis.

  • Undergraduate or graduate degree in Engineering, Quantity Surveying, Construction Management, Business, or related discipline.

  • Knowledge of construction contract formation including service and consultant agreements.

  • Ability to administer post-award contracts including change management and claims negotiation.

  • Familiarity with Unit Price, Time & Materials, and Lump Sum contracts.

  • Understanding of Work Breakdown Structures (WBS) and progress measurement methodologies.

  • Advanced skills in MS Office, SharePoint, project management and reporting systems, and database applications.

  • Strong analytical, communication, negotiation, and reporting skills.
